Problem
Existing windscreen wiper devices with inclined upper surfaces experience uneven stresses on their components, leading to local damages, wear, and aging, particularly when used with air deflecting designs, which affects wiping quality.
Innovation Solution
A windscreen wiper device with a connecting device featuring a U-shaped second part and reinforcement means ensures that bending locations of its legs lie in the same horizontal plane, reducing stress and wear by using a channel with an inclined base and transverse ribs to distribute pressure evenly, and incorporating a resilient tongue and protrusions for secure attachment.

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Object-affected harmful factors
If an inclined upper surface of the second part of the connecting device is used to achieve an air deflecting effect, then air deflection performance is improved, but uneven stresses occur on the front side and back side of the second part, leading to local damages, wear and aging
Solution Approach 1:
The patent applies asymmetry by providing different geometries to the front side and back side of the second part. The front side has a first geometry optimized for air deflection with an inclined upper surface, while the back side has a second geometry that provides reinforcement at bending locations. This asymmetric design allows each side to be optimized for its specific function without compromising the other.
Solution Approach 2:
The patent applies local quality by providing reinforcement means specifically at the bending locations on the back side of the second part. These reinforcement means (such as ribs or increased wall thickness) are localized only where bending stresses occur during mounting, rather than uniformly throughout the entire second part. This allows the inclined upper surface to maintain its air deflection geometry while specific areas receive additional strength where needed.
2Reliability
If reinforcement means are added to equalize bending stresses, then structural reliability is improved, but device complexity increases
Solution Approach 1:
The patent merges the reinforcement means with the second part of the connecting device itself. The reinforcement features (such as ribs or thickened sections) are integrated directly into the molded structure of the second part rather than being separate components. This combining approach provides the necessary structural reinforcement while avoiding additional parts, assembly steps, or complex manufacturing processes.

A windscreen wiper device of the flat blade type comprising an elastic, elongated carrier element, as well as an elongated wiper blade of a flexible material, which can be placed in abutment with a windscreen to be wiped, which wiper blade includes at least one longitudinal slit, in which slit at least one longitudinal strip of the carrier element is disposed, which windscreen wiper device comprises a connecting device for a rod-like extension of an oscillating arm, wherein said rod-like extension can be pivotally connected to said connecting device about a pivot axis near a free end thereof, wherein said connecting device comprises a first part and a second part, wherein said rod-like extension of said oscillating arm can be pivotally connected to said first part about said pivot axis, with the interposition of said second part, wherein said first part is connected to said wiper blade and said second part is detachably snapped onto said first part, with the special feature that said second part comprises a channel arranged to receive said free end of said rod-like extension, wherein said second part has a U-shaped cross-section having an inclined base and two legs extending downwardly from said base, and wherein said second part comprises reinforcement means to arrange that bending locations of said legs upon snapping said second part onto said first part lie in the same horizontal plane.
